The Southeast Asia Interdisciplinary Institute was established in Manila by Sister Jackie Blondin in 1975 to offer graduate and post-graduate programs in Organization Development and Instructional Development. It is a boutique institution in the sense that it specializes in these two disciplines. The degree (MA and PhD) and non-degree OD programs are offered by the SAIDI School of OD. The faculty for these programs consist of full time SAIDI facilitators, supervisors, and mentors as well as resource persons from other academic institutions, government, non-government and private organizations. SAIDI students come from all walks of life and from all over the world. SAIDI is known for its brand of academic programs in Organization Development. Being a degreegranting institution recognized by the Commission on Higher Education (CHED), SAIDI has established its niche in providing quality and learner-centered Master of Arts and Doctor of Philosophy degrees. However, SAIDI has not only established its OD expertise from its distinguished roster of faculty and alumni, but also in its involvements outside the academic field. Presently, the main SAIDI campus is situated in the hills of Antipolo, away from the noise of Manila. Facilities include workshop rooms, lecture halls, library, living and dining facilities, internet wi-fi, multi-purpose halls, prayer room and quiet places for silence and contemplation.
4 Overview of the COD The SAIDI COD blends together several learning modules that are delivered through a guided distance learning format. It combines web-based training technology such as e-learning and virtual classroom with a 5-days classroom learning experience led by experienced OD experts as facilitators. The candidates are expected to complete an integrative work-based final assignment that provides an opportunity to immediately apply new knowledge and skills to their work.
